Double Dragon Trilogy Dated for iOS and Android

double-dragon-trilogy-dated

Retro brawler Double Dragon, Double Dragon 2: The Revenge, and Double Dragon 3: The Rosetta Stone will be released for iOS and Android as the Double Dragon Trilogy. Developers DotEmu has implemented some tweaks in the game, including an Arcade and Story game mode, three difficulty levels, the choice between the original and remastered soundtracks, compability with iOS Game Center and Google Play Game Service, co-op mode via Bluetooth, and gamepad support.

The Double Dragon series was a popular arcade game in the 1980s that saw ports to Gameboy, Xbox Live Arcade, NES, and several other platforms. The game will be released by the end of 2013 on iTunes and Google Play.

World of Warcraft Battle Chest Expands

wow-battle-chest-revamp

Getting Blizzard’s legendary MMO just became easier today. The World of Warcraft package was previous known as the Battle Chest and only contained the base game and The Burning Crusade. Now, the package contains the base game, The Burning Crusade, Wrath of the Lich King, and Cataclysm for the price of £9.99. It can be purchased as a DVD in retail stores or as a downloadable file on Battle.net.

World of Warcraft is nearing its 10 year anniversary after becoming the MMORPG that all other MMOs would be compared to. The game boasts 7 million subscribers and is on its fourth expansion pack, Mists of Pandaria.

Halo: Spartan Assault Coming to Xbox 360 and Xbox One

After releasing for PC and Windows 8 phones, Halo: Spartan Assault will be making the transition to consoles later this year for both the Xbox 360 and Xbox One. Adding in new content along with the Operation Hydra expansion previously released to the original version, console players will not only get the chance to experience the story of Sarah Palmer’s rise to the top of the Spartan IV’s, but join in with a friend.

Halo: Spartan Assault will be adding in a new co-op feature exclusively for the console version of the game, though unfortunately there will not be any cross-platform play between 360 and One. The co-op mode isn’t the only console exclusive however, as it will also include the first ever encounter with the Flood in Spartan Assault, along with a host of new weapons, armor abilities, and upgrades.

Halo: Spartan Assault is set to release for both the Xbox 360 and the Xbox One in December 2014.

Infinite Crisis Holding Closed Beta Cup

Warner Bros. and Turbine are looking to spice up its closed beta process for Infinite Crisis with a Closed Beta Cup in association with the Electronic Sports League (ESL). This closed beta cup will be taking place over the course of three months beginning on November 10th, with weekly events ending every Sunday where the eight best teams will receive points and the top team winning €200. At the end of each month, the eight team with the most points will compete to decide the top two teams who will be splitting a prize of €500.

While the MOBA isn’t set to release unto 2014, this seems like a pretty good way for Infinite Crisis to do a good amount of stress and balance testing, especially with the prize money on the line.
